We had another busy week at TalkAndroid so here’s a recap of all the top stories. Last week, the Cyanogen corporation was formed and this week we found out their first partner is going to be OPPO. Surprisingly there wasn’t much news about the Nexus 5, but the HTC One Max continues to capture some buzz. However late in the week, news about HTC working on a Butterfly 2 has us very excited. Samsung reminds us they have been making gold phones before the iPhone ever existed. They also seem to be the first company applying a “regional SIM lock.” Is it a big deal? What about the Moto X? Could it be one of the best phones this year now that Motorola has fixed the camera issues? It’s time to get caught up and get ready for another exciting week.
